Eligibility: The minimum qualification required for entry into B.Ed. course is Bachelor of Arts (B.A), Bachelor of Science (B.Sc.) or Bachelor of Commerce (B.Com.) from a recognised board/university with at least 50% marks. If you fulfill the score, you are eligible to pursue B.Ed.
